Send cached target duration when creating sessions

This fixes an issue where the default target duration was being sent
when re-creating sessions, after the true target duration was already
known. This caused the wrong value in PowerHAL, and no corrective update
was sent because the cached value never changed.

Bug: 301806277
Test: hwuitest
